About this activity
During the Middle Ages, profits from the Kutna Hora silver mines brought fame to the lands of the Czech Crown, and Kutna Hora became the richest and most powerful town.
Admire the Gothic St. Barbara's Cathedral with its valuable murals and the former royal mint which once produced so-called Prague groschen and gold ducats. To date Kutna Hora has retained the character of a medieval city and rightly belongs to the most important UNESCO heritage sites in the Czech Republic.
